Validating email addresses is crucial for maintaining data integrity and ensuring effective communication in web applications. In Laravel, you can enhance your email validation process by integrating with external services like the Mailbox Layer API. This service provides real-time email verification, helping you determine whether an email address is valid, deliverable, and not associated with temporary email providers.
Here’s a general approach to using the Mailbox Layer API for email validation in your Laravel application:
First, sign up for an account on Mailbox Layer to get your API key. This key is essential for authenticating your requests to the API.
Store your API key in your .env file for secure access. For example:
MAILBOX_LAYER_API_KEY=your_api_key_here
Develop a service class in Laravel that handles interactions with the Mailbox Layer API. This class will encapsulate the logic for making requests and processing responses.
Within your service class, implement the method to validate email addresses using the Mailbox Layer API. This method will send a request to the API, passing the email address to be validated and returning the validation result.
Integrate your email validation service within your application, such as in form requests or controllers. When a user submits an email address, call the validation method to check its validity before proceeding with any further actions.
